LAHORE: The city wore a festive look as all public and private buildings have been decorated with colourful lights and buntings in the provincial capital to mark the Eid Milad-un-Nabi (PBUH).

Children have made colourful small hills with sands in the streets and roads and put their toys on them which depict the culture of Arab.

The people are also preparing to participate in the main procession of Eid Miladun Nabi (PBUH) which will march towards Data Darbar from Delhi gate and conclude at Data Darbar. A car rally will also be held in Phase-5 DHA Lahore to mark the birthday of Holy Prophet Muhammad (PBUH).
